I'm confused because the order pin P/N: MT5656ZDX -V but the model number doesn't have the V on it. what a headache this software is becoming! <{POST_SNAPBACK}> I emailed multitech support and they replied with this: The modem in question is most likely a voice modem. To verify this fact use Hyperterminal and give command Ati ENTER. The command for setting voice mode on this modem is AT+FCLASS=8 and to display its capabilities do AT+FCLASS=? Then ENTER The GENDER CHANGER should have no effect on the voice capabilities, however, if the GENDER CHANGER is of the wrong type you might not be able to send commands to the modem.
